- Safety-Focused Operations:
Execute operations by following designated routes and schedules, maintaining safety protocols and traffic regulations. - Passenger Care:
Provide assistance to passengers, ensuring smooth boarding, comfortable rides, and timely disembarkation. - Vehicle Vigilance:
Conduct pre-trip and post-trip inspections, report maintenance issues, and maintain cleanliness and safety equipment readiness. - Adherence to Protocols:
Enforce seat belt use, follow emergency procedures, and comply with regulatory mandates. - Other duties as required
- 21 years or older
- Valid CDL Class A or B with passenger and airbrake endorsement
- Minimum 3 years of driving experience (personal or professional)
- Excellent communication and customer service skills
- Ability to work shifts or flexible schedules as needed
- Subject to DOT drug testing and physical if applicable (49 CFR Part 40). No use of Schedule I drugs, including cannabis
- Work outdoors in varying temperatures and weather conditions
- Sit for extended periods; stand and move as required during shifts
- Ability to push/pull up to 20 pounds and lift up to 50 pounds occasionally
- Operate in high-traffic environments; tolerate dust, vehicle fumes and noise
